SOUTH BEND, Ind. –– Team USA women's wrestling took to the mat on Tuesday to continue preparation for the 2021 Olympic games. For Sarah Hildebrandt, a Michiana native, she said it's the perfect place to wrap up her training.
This training camp will be the final of its kind for Team USA, before they head to Tokyo.
